开发者社区 问答 正文

OceanBase数据库 dbcat报错,连接串貌似没有识别-t租户参数?

OceanBase数据库 dbcat报错,连接串貌似没有识别-t租户参数?add3aebc9190719a80b055687ee5de0e.png

展开
收起
真的很搞笑 2023-12-12 19:58:26 79 分享 版权
来自: OceanBase
2 条回答
写回答
取消 提交回答
  • -uroot@租户#集群 试下 ,此回答整理自钉群“[社区]技术答疑群OceanBase”

    2023-12-13 13:05:22
    赞同 展开评论
  • 面对过去,不要迷离;面对未来,不必彷徨;活在今天,你只要把自己完全展示给别人看。

    如果您在使用dbcat命令连接OceanBase数据库时遇到了问题,可以尝试以下解决方案:

    1. 检查连接串格式:确保您的连接串中包含了正确的参数和值。例如,正确的连接串格式应该类似于:
    jdbc:mysql://<host>:<port>/<database>?useUnicode=true&characterEncoding=utf8&zeroDateTimeBehavior=convertToNull&serverTimezone=UTC&useSSL=false&allowPublicKeyRetrieval=true
    

    其中,<host>是OceanBase数据库的主机名或IP地址,<port>是端口号,<database>是要连接的数据库名称。如果需要指定租户(tenant),可以在连接串中使用-t参数,例如:

    jdbc:mysql://<host>:<port>/<database>?useUnicode=true&characterEncoding=utf8&zeroDateTimeBehavior=convertToNull&serverTimezone=UTC&useSSL=false&allowPublicKeyRetrieval=true&tenant=<tenant_name>
    
    1. 检查租户名称:确保您指定的租户名称是正确的。您可以在OceanBase数据库中查询租户列表,以确认要连接的租户是否存在。

    2. 检查JDBC驱动版本:确保您使用的JDBC驱动版本与OceanBase数据库兼容。您可以查看OceanBase官方文档或联系技术支持获取更多信息。

    2023-12-12 21:56:13
    赞同 展开评论